Output 3f8e712b29fa786e67d60445e2209b14f633009672a262f2aa8ae1f5bb0fb5a5:1

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ae436b7bdfa10998c66d75775d2d4895dc137bca OP_EQUAL
address
3HaSGLT7v1FMwLq9vC1c35HjykNidRYEcS
transaction
3f8e712b29fa786e67d60445e2209b14f633009672a262f2aa8ae1f5bb0fb5a5
spent
true